Output 54d9b96be07c60153ee693e682c03143d353d1415359e942bf2d03432f93a637:0

value
17939729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c3289571ed19496945c10f4d5323b187d1a447b OP_EQUAL
address
3D1iFff4YJeTfKANNKebUpHVGxmzhDRL9t
transaction
54d9b96be07c60153ee693e682c03143d353d1415359e942bf2d03432f93a637
spent
true